Drainage geonets are essential for efficient water flow in various applications. These products help control soil erosion and improve drainage efficiency in agricultural and construction projects.
Recent designs focus on increasing durability and performance. Innovative materials are developed to resist environmental challenges like UV rays and chemical exposure. These enhancements lead to longer-lasting solutions. However, there’s a delicate balance between durability and cost-effectiveness. Some designs might still be too expensive for widespread adoption.

Innovative drainage geonets are transforming construction and landscaping. They offer solutions that traditional materials simply can't match. Traditional drainage systems often struggle with water flow and soil stability. They may clog over time, leading to costly repairs. In contrast, innovative geonets provide enhanced water management and soil reinforcement.
These advanced materials are designed to promote better drainage. They are lighter and easier to install. This can save time on construction projects. Their unique structure allows for superior flow rates, reducing the risk of flooding and erosion. It’s essential to assess your project needs carefully. Not all geonets are equal in performance.
